Could UCLA football benefit from trading (card) deadline?

December 3, 2008 |  2:20 pm

UCLA's Brigham Harwell, left, Kahlil Bell and Michael Norris emerge from the tunnel before the game against Stanford in October.

UCLA's marketing department has been oddly quiet this week. The same crew that lured nearly 20,000 Fresno State fans to the Rose Bowl after promising them they would see "history" has been silent about Saturday's USC game, even though tickets were still available as of Monday morning.

Imagine the possibilities -- "Come see the first of two USC victories at the Rose Bowl this season," or, "The Rose Bowl: UCLA's home ... USC's office."

Still, the boys in the department aren't just sitting around playing "Monopoly." They announced a special "trading card" promotion through Bruin Locker Room -- an effort to make sure there are more UCLA fans than USC fans at the Rose Bowl?

"As we salute the seniors, take home a Bruin souvenir of these fine student-athletes. The first 10,000 fans wearing blue will receive trading cards that feature the entire 2008 senior class. Trading cards will be distributed at all Rose Bowl gates beginning at noon."

Which could lead to interesting future negotiations: "I'll give you six Kahlil Bells for one Mark Sanchez. OK, eight Bells and one Brigham Harwell. No? Well, then...."

As for the long-term investment possibilities, a Topps rookie card for Reggie Bush still fetches more than one for Maurice Jones-Drew, even though Jones-Drew holds the edge in career rushing yards (2,261 to 1,440).

-- Chris Foster
